French Ligue 1 side Nantes FC are reportedly keen on signing Majeed Waris on a permanent basis this summer.
The Ghanaian international is currently on a season-long loan deal from Portuguese giants FC Porto.
The 27-year old has been impressive for the Ligue 1 side as they continue to battle it out of the regulation zone.
According to reports in France, The Canaries are ready to meet his € 6 million asking price .
Waris has scored seven goals and made three assists in the ongoing season and has become an key member of the squad.
